A Black man identified as Jaylen Smith, has become the youngest Black mayor in the United States to get elected as Mayor of Earle.

Smith who was 18 years old  just graduated from high school, won the election with 218 votes and has been  called the youngest Black mayor in the US by the American media.

Announcing his victory on Facebook, Smith said, “Citizens of Earle, Arkansas, it’s official!! I am your newly elected Mayor of Earle, Arkansas…,”

 

“It’s Time to Build a Better Chapter of Earle, Arkansas.”

 

 

“I would like to thank all my supporters for stepping up getting people to the polls. I am truly grateful for you all.”
